Sn3 and Sn10 sulfonate–oxide–hydroxide clusters with two different sulfonate binding modes

Abstract

A tin sulfonate–oxidehydroxide tetracation with two different sulfonate bindings, an electrostatic and a monohapto covalent one, and a tin sulfonate–oxidehydroxide monocation with two other kinds of sulfonate bindings, an electrostatic and a dihapto bridging one are described here.
